Joshua Irving leads early at Texas North Amateur

PROSPER, Texas — Joshua Irving of Forth Worth fired an opening round 6-under par 66 to lead the Texas North Amateur. Irving’s low number was the result of six consecutive birdies as he made the turn. Despite two bogeys on the day, Irving remains two strokes ahead of Flower Mound’s Andrew Spear.

Spear, a product of the Legends Junior Tour, opened the first round of the North Amateur with a 4-under par 68, closing his round with a birdie on the lengthy par five 18th hole at Gentle Creek Country Club.

A sunny afternoon in Prosper saw multiple under-par rounds to start the North Amateur Championship, presented by UST Mamiya. The fourth in a series of regional events conducted by the Texas Golf Association, the North Amateur is being contested at Gentle Creek Country Club in the North Texas community of Propser.

Rounding out the top of the leaderboard were Brad Gibson of Plano and Zach Sudinsky of McKinney, who each carded 3-under par 69’s to position themselves in contention heading into the weekend.

Gentle Creek Country Club is no stranger to hosting events conducted by the Texas Golf Association. The club previously held the 2009 North Senior Amateur, which was won by Prosper native Jim Hays, who captured the regional championship by four shots and finishing three under par for the championship.

Designed by D.A. Weibring, Gentle Creek Country Club is nestled in a natural wooded setting that has the potential to play over 7,300 yards with no shortage of challenging holes tee to green.

The second round of the North Amateur presented by UST Mamiya gets underway tomorrow, August 1st, at 7:30 am off both the first and tenth tees. At the conclusion of the second round tomorrow, the field will be re- paired, based on total score from the first 36 holes of play.

ABOUT THE Texas North Amateur

Eligibility: Entries are open to male amateur golfers who are 25 years of age or older by the tournament start date and residing in the North Texas region as defined by the Texas PGA Sections (North of 31 degree parallel, Salado TX and north is break point). Applicants must have a certified USGA Handicap Index of 8.4 or less.

Format: 54 holes Stroke Play. No Cut.

Field limit: 81 players
